17 lines
363 B
TypeScript
17 lines
363 B
TypeScript
import type { Key } from "react-aria-components"
|
|
|
|
export const enum DateName {
|
|
date = "date",
|
|
month = "month",
|
|
year = "year",
|
|
}
|
|
|
|
export interface SelectProps
|
|
extends Omit<React.SelectHTMLAttributes<HTMLSelectElement>, "onSelect"> {
|
|
items: number[]
|
|
label: string
|
|
name: DateName
|
|
onSelect: (key: Key, name: DateName) => void
|
|
placeholder?: string
|
|
}
|